find_all had the following bug:

Imagine you have the following code:

for label in find_all(Text('Label')):
    print(Link(to_right_of=label).href)

The bug was that this used the same Link for each label, producing output for links that actually were not to_right_of the label in the loop.

Furthermore, this release also changes the behavior of find_all in the following way. Say you have four buttons in a 2x2 grid:

image

Previously, the following code used to return two buttons:

find_all(Button("Duplicate Button"), below=Button("Duplicate Button"))

(Namely, the two buttons in the second row, because they are both under a "Duplicate Button").

Now, this only returns one button (the first button in the second row). If you want both, you can still do:

for button in find_all(Button("Duplicate Button")):
    find_all(Button("Duplicate Button", below=button))

This release is a major version bump (6.x.x) because it changes the elements returned by Helium's API and may therefore be backwards-incompatible.
